WebMay 6, 2024 · The definition. The interbank exchange rate has its name because it’s the rate that banks use when they’re trading large amounts of foreign currencies with one another. The interbank rate is also called the mid-market rate, the spot rate, or the real exchange rate. Unfortunately, this rate is pretty much always reserved for big banks and ... You can complete the definition of currency stability given by … WebEurocurrency Definition. Eurocurrency refers to any currency deposited in banks anywhere outside the country that issued it. These currencies belong to non-residents of a nation. Foreign-based banks lend these to anyone who wants to use them in the country where they are legal tender.
